Kristie developed an eating disorder in her teenage years, competing on the world stage as an elite athlete. She sought treatment in Australia and New Zealand where she became 'functional' in life, but still had constant thoughts about food and body image in her mind. She relapsed again 9 years later and was this time told that she was chronic and should expect to have to 'manage' her eating disorder for the rest of her life.

Not satisfied with this, Kristie researched treatment options and travelled to California to attend treatment at Monte Nido. Immediately stunned by the quality of the program and expertise of the staff she made a wild promise to herself that if she ever recovered, she would set up a residential treatment centre in New Zealand so that others would have access to this level and quality of support.

Firstly, Kristie set up Recovered Living in the USA which provides online and live-in support to people in recovery. Her team of Recovery Coaches are all fully recovered and endlessly dedicated to supporting others to do the same.

Kristie was invited to present at the 2018 TEDx event in New Zealand. Since that time she has been driven to create a charitable residential treatment centre in New Zealand, that operates on a not-for-profit basis.

Recovered Living NZ is on track to open its doors in 2022 with a 6 bed residential and a 6 place day program.
